Germany is a leading country in Central Europe, well known for its strong economy, advanced technology, rich history, and high-quality education system. It is one of the most influential nations in the European Union and a top destination for international students.
1. Capital: Berlin Largest
2. City: Berlin
3. Official Language: German
4. Currency: Euro (EUR)
5. Government: Federal Parliamentary Republic
6. Population: Approximately 84 million
7. Time Zone: Central European Time (CET)
Strong Education & Research Germany is globally respected for its universities, research institutions, and innovation-driven education, especially in engineering, medicine, IT, and applied sciences. Many public universities offer low or no tuition fees.
Germany has a deep cultural heritage shaped by philosophers, scientists, musicians, and writers such as Goethe, Beethoven, and Einstein. Historic castles, museums, and UNESCO World Heritage sites reflect its diverse past.
As the home of global brands like BMW, Mercedes-Benz, Siemens, and Bosch, Germany is a powerhouse in engineering, manufacturing, and industrial research, offering excellent career and internship opportunities.
Germany offers excellent public transport, healthcare, safety, and a balanced lifestyle. Cities like Berlin, Munich, Hamburg, and Frankfurt are modern, multicultural, and student-friendly.
From the Bavarian Alps and Black Forest to scenic rivers like the Rhine and Danube, Germany combines modern urban life with beautiful natural landscapes.
